【数字逻辑电路控制信号】在数字逻辑电路中,控制信号是实现电路功能的关键组成部分。它们用于协调各个逻辑模块的运行,确保数据在正确的时间和顺序下被处理。控制信号通常由时钟信号、使能信号、复位信号等组成,根据不同的电路设计需求进行配置。
一、控制信号概述
控制信号是数字系统中用于管理操作流程的信号,它们决定了电路在特定时刻执行哪些操作。这些信号可以来自外部输入,也可以由内部状态机或控制器生成。常见的控制信号包括:
- 时钟信号(Clock):用于同步电路中的所有操作。
- 使能信号(Enable):控制某个模块是否工作。
- 复位信号(Reset):将电路恢复到初始状态。
- 选择信号(Select):用于多路选择器或数据路径的选择。
- 模式控制信号(Mode Control):决定电路的工作模式。
二、常见控制信号及其作用
控制信号名称 | 功能描述 | 应用场景 |
时钟信号 | 同步电路操作 | 触发器、计数器、状态机等 |
使能信号 | 控制模块是否激活 | 寄存器、存储器、ALU等 |
复位信号 | 初始化电路状态 | 系统启动、错误恢复 |
选择信号 | 选择数据路径或功能 | 多路复用器、数据选择器 |
模式控制信号 | 设置电路工作模式 | 多功能芯片、可编程逻辑器件 |
三、控制信号的设计与优化
在设计数字逻辑电路时,控制信号的合理配置对系统的性能和稳定性至关重要。设计过程中需要注意以下几点:
1. 时序匹配:确保控制信号与时钟信号同步,避免竞争和冒险现象。
2. 信号完整性:减少噪声干扰,保证信号传输的可靠性。
3. 资源优化:合理使用逻辑门和触发器,降低功耗和面积。
4. 可测试性:设计易于测试的控制逻辑,便于故障诊断。
四、总结
控制信号在数字逻辑电路中扮演着至关重要的角色,它们不仅影响电路的功能实现,还直接关系到系统的稳定性和效率。通过对控制信号的合理设计和优化,可以有效提升数字系统的性能和可靠性。在实际应用中,需要根据具体需求选择合适的控制信号类型,并结合电路结构进行综合考虑。